yes he would, but even if you committed an offense that merits excommunication, if you are a minor, or not aware of that penalty or the gravity of the offense, you are not excommunicated in any case.I also have another problem.
For some reason, lately, my memory has been filled with paradoxes so I won’t even begin to explain this problem but only ask: would a confessor tell you if you were excommunicated or not?
Yes, a confessor would. If someone is excommunicated, they cannot receive the Church’s sacraments, so logically a priest would need to absolve the excommunication before receiving the confession (or if they are not authorised to lift the excommunication, they would advise you).I also have another problem.
